Dovetailed pine tool box with black walnut veneered lid and quartersawn lacewood veneered drawers.

This tool box was the very first project we undertook at Algonquin College in Ottawa. It is built using handtools and traditional joinery. It features, dovetails, half blind dovetails, slot dovetails. The woods used are pine, black walnut burl veneer, australian lacewood, Baltic Birch Plywood. The finish is one coat of shellac followed up by numerous coats of danish oil.
Design or Plan used: Algonquin College
